E‑Bike Rentals at Ballum Camping: What to Know

Quick answer: E‑bike rental at Ballum Camping costs 150 DKK per day.

Here are the essentials at a glance:

Item Details
Price 150 DKK per day
On‑site availability E‑bikes available to hire directly at the campsite
Fleet We rent 2 Raleigh E‑bikes
Need more bikes? Reserve additional/other bikes online in advance via Fahrrad Wollesen
Maintenance Free bike station on the campsite for basic upkeep
Charging on tent field Designated hikers’/cyclists’ tent field has a power outlet to charge your phone or bike for free
Charging on pitches Camping pitches have 10A power; electricity is metered and billed per kWh
Where you’ll ride The North Sea Cycle Route runs right along the campground

Where to Ride: Car‑Free Ideas from Your Pitch

You don’t need detailed maps to enjoy memorable routes here. Start with these tried‑and‑true themes and adapt to your pace and interests.

North Sea Cycle Route sampler

Roll straight from the gate onto a legendary long‑distance route that passes through every country around the North Sea. Sample a nearby stretch for coastal views, big skies, and classic Wadden Sea scenery. Turn around whenever you like—e‑bikes make out‑and‑back rides a pleasure.

Wadden Sea dike out‑and‑back

Trace the sea dike for open horizons and abundant birdlife. This is an ideal wind‑aware ride: use e‑assist to take the edge off headwinds and enjoy a relaxed cruise back.

Village‑hopping for cafés and culture

Create a gentle loop that strings together local lanes and small towns. The region offers easy access to historic towns like Tønder, Møgeltønder, and Ribe—perfect for browsing, photos, and a slow lunch before you roll home.

Add an island flavor to your day

The Wadden islands Rømø and Mandø are not far away. Plan a longer outing centered on sea views and island ambience, then return to camp for a warm shower and a cozy evening.
